Mayo Lake Minerals Inc. is an exploration stage junior mining company. The Company is engaged in the exploration and development of approximately five precious metal projects in the Tombstone Gold (Plutonic) Belt of the Tintina Gold Province. Its projects include Carlin- Roop Silver Project, Anderson-Davidson, Trail-Minto, Edmonton, and Cascade. The projects cover over 244 square kilometers in the Yukon's Mayo Mining District and lie within the traditional territory of the Na-Cho Nyak Dun First Nation. The Company is focusing on its two significant properties: the Carlin-Roop Silver Project, which is lying within the Keno Hill Silver District, and the Anderson-Davidson gold property, which comprises over 627 contiguous quartz claims covering an area of 129.4 square kilometers, near the community of Mayo, Yukon Territory. The Company also holds two active mines: Victoria Gold's Eagle Gold Mine and Hecla Mining's Keno Silver Mine, which are nearby.
